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Lower Moreland High School (Huntingdon Valley, PA)
Lower Moreland High School is situated in Huntingdon Valley, a suburban community in Montgomery County, Pennsylvania. It's located approximately 15 miles north of Philadelphia, offering a blend of suburban tranquility with convenient access to urban amenities. The primary access point for the school is Red Lion Road, which connects to major arteries like Huntingdon Pike (PA-232) and Roosevelt Boulevard (US-1). Interstate 95 and the Pennsylvania Turnpike (I-276) are accessible within a short driving distance, facilitating travel from wider regions. For those flying in, Philadelphia International Airport (PHL) is the closest major airport, roughly a 45-minute to an hour drive depending on traffic. SEPTA public transportation offers bus routes that serve the general area, though direct school access might require a short transfer or rideshare. Weather & Seasons at Lower Moreland High School
- Winter: Winter in Huntingdon Valley is generally cold, with average temperatures ranging from the low 20s to the low 40s Fahrenheit. Snowfall is common, sometimes impacting travel and event schedules. Visitors should pack warm layers, including heavy coats, hats, gloves, and waterproof footwear. Outdoor events require careful monitoring of weather forecasts to ensure participant safety and comfort.
- Spring & early summer: Spring weather is variable, with temperatures gradually warming from the 40s into the 70s Fahrenheit, but occasional cold snaps can occur. Rain is frequent, contributing to lush greenery. Early summer maintains pleasant temperatures in the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it, offering ideal conditions for outdoor athletics. Light jackets and comfortable walking shoes are recommended for these transitional periods.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er, from July to August, is typically hot and humid, with temperatures frequently reaching the high 80s and 90s Fahrenheit. Air conditioning becomes essential for indoor comfort. For outdoor events, hydration is crucial, and seeking shade or scheduling activities for cooler parts of the day is advisable. Pack light, breathable clothing.
- Fall season: Fall brings a refreshing change, with temperatures cooling from the 70s Fahrenheit in September down to the 40s and 50s by November. The air becomes crisp, and the landscape turns vibrant with autumn colors. This season is often considered ideal for outdoor sports. Layered clothing, including sweaters and light jackets, is practical for variable fall weather.
- Rain & snow: Rain is common throughout the year, particularly in spring and fall, and can occur at any time. Snow is primarily a winter phenomenon. During rainy or snowy conditions, indoor venues and activities become more appealing. Visitors should always check local weather reports before traveling, as significant precipitation can affect road conditions and outdoor event feasibility.
